I worked at Spectrecom for several years making high quality films that I was proud to be involved with, and many projects that took me to different parts of the world – there are some great opportunities here if you have ambition. Every member of the team is professional and supportive and there's a real family vibe that’s experienced right across the company. Spectrecom allowed me the opportunity to broaden my career opportunities and increase my knowledge and application of practical filmmaking. I found myself progressing very quickly from camera assist to camera operator, and in later years I directed a number of projects, which later went on to win industry awards. I suspect there are very few other production companies around that would afford that level of experience so early in a person’s career. Myself and many of my colleagues at Spectrecom have now gone on to enjoy successful freelance careers, and it's doubtful that we’d have the same opportunities in the industry today without having first built up skills, knowledge, experience and contacts during time spent at Spectrecom. Contrary to what some other reviewers have said on here, the management team actually care about its staff, having introduced lieu hours, which is rare in our industry, and introducing the living wage 5 years before it became a legal requirement. In recent times there has also been investment in a brand new van, camera equipment and editing facilities, meaning that Spectrecom can continue producing excellent work without the worry of kit failing or the van breaking down (which has happened before a number of times), all very important things to consider when working to deadlines. The company culture strikes a good balance between being friendly, professional and ambitious, meaning that Spectrecom will continue to be a good choice for anyone considering working with them in future.

Cons

There have at times been delays in freelancers being paid on time, and as a freelancer myself I know how frustrating that can be. However, I completed a freelance job recently for Spectrecom and payment was met on time within my payment terms. The company has grown exponentially in the past few years, and this accelerated growth has meant that from time to time there have been break-downs in communication, leading to mistakes being made on projects. However, in my experience the management team have been responsive to difficulties experienced on projects, and work together to ensure that problems are immediately addressed and working processes constantly reviewed and updated
